Some programs let you specialize in fields like economics, finance, business, or health care.Ĭomputer science: The emphasis on statistical and analytical skills in many computer science programs makes them a good fit for aspiring data analysts. In this degree program, you’ll typically take courses in computer science, statistics, and mathematics. If you’re looking toward a career as a data analyst, these majors could be a good fit.ĭata science: In response to the increasing demand for data professionals, more and more schools are offering bachelor’s degrees in data science.
